Ivan Bianchi 
Kazan Cathedral, St Petersburg 
1865 (ca) 
  
Albumen print 
25.4 x 34.3 cm (image) 
  
The Royal Collection 
Acquired by King Edward VII when Prince of Wales. RCIN 2933787 
  
 
LL/92382 
  
Curatorial description (Accessed: 30 July 2019)
Photograph of Kazan Cathedral in St Petersburg. The cathedral has a dome, a central pediment and a long curved colonnade. In front of the cathedral there is a cobbled courtyard with a pile of building materials to the right. This photograph is from an album of handwritten and printed documents and photographs collected by Captain Oliver Montagu during the 1874 visit to Russia by the Prince and Princess of Wales, later King Edward VII and Queen Alexandra. They had travelled to Russia to attend the wedding of Prince Alfred, Duke of Edinburgh and Saxe-Coburg & Gotha to Grand Duchess Maria Alexandrovna, the daughter of Alexander II.
